Advanced Neural Networks for Molecular Science
Our deep learning models analyze vast biological datasets to identify promising drug candidates with unprecedented precision. Each model is trained on curated pharmacological and genomic data spanning decades of research.
- Molecular structure analysis and 3D conformation prediction
- Protein binding affinity prediction across target families
- Drug–target interaction modeling with mechanistic insight
- ADMET property prediction for pharmacokinetic profiling
- Multi-objective lead optimization with generative AI
